Navy fencing off private lands in Mullaitheevu – Land owners call for immediate action

The Navy is fencing off lands owned by private owners are being fenced off by the Navy at Mullaitheevu,Mulliyawalai and Vadduvagal, said the people. 312 acre belonging to 32 families and 300 acre state lands were being fenced now.

In the context of several demands and requests were made to release land occupied by navy earlier without any success, A discussion was held regarding the release of lands, presided by the Actg. Secretary to Ministry of Defence on January 16th this year, at the District Secretariat. The Actg. Secretary had said a reply will be given before the end of February, but no reply whatsoever had been given

The District Secretary said that he had not been informed of the fencing, but on the contrary, the Navy promised to release some lands soon, in a conference  at the Colombo “Temple Trees” presided by the  Secretary to the President.
